Tire Mfg Date Help

So I took my 4R in for a balance as it was running strange at highway speeds and found out according to Toyota my new BF KO2's are from 2011. I took a look at the mfg date on the tire and it reads 7111 (picture below), however, last time i checked there are not 71 weeks in a year. Can someone help me understand when my tires were actually mfg before I go to the shop that sold and installed them?

The first four letters/numbers after DOT indicate the manufacturer & plant code and the tire size code.

The next set of four letters/numbers indicate the manufacturer's identity or construction code. It is a little confusing that they chose to use all numbers in your case (thinking it might be the date code).

These eight letters/numbers are what you are reading on the sidewall of your tire as they are currently mounted (facing outwards).

As suggested by @Sky the date code (final set of four numbers) will be visible on the other side of the tire.
